About Converting Grains per Teaspoon to US hundredweights per Gallon

Grain per Teaspoon and US hundredweight per Gallon both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.

Formula

us hundredweights per gallon = grains per teaspoon × 0.00109714285714

This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 grain per teaspoon equals 13.1466708828 base units, and 1 us hundredweight per gallon equals 11982.6427317 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ct grain per teaspoon-to-us hundredweight per gallon factor of 0.00109714285714.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?

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
